Photo de profile OK, modif nom, prénom, tel OK
This commit is contained in:
@ -64,12 +64,14 @@ class _LoginPageState extends State<LoginPage> {
|
||||
// Maintenant que toutes les données sont chargées, naviguer vers CalendarPage.
|
||||
Navigator.of(context).pushReplacementNamed('/calendar');
|
||||
} else {
|
||||
if (!mounted) return;
|
||||
setState(() {
|
||||
_errorMessage = "Aucune donnée utilisateur trouvée.";
|
||||
_isLoading = false;
|
||||
});
|
||||
}
|
||||
} on FirebaseAuthException catch (e) {
|
||||
if (!mounted) return;
|
||||
setState(() {
|
||||
_isLoading = false;
|
||||
if (e.code == 'user-not-found' || e.code == 'wrong-password') {
|
||||
@ -81,6 +83,7 @@ class _LoginPageState extends State<LoginPage> {
|
||||
}
|
||||
});
|
||||
} catch (e) {
|
||||
if (!mounted) return;
|
||||
setState(() {
|
||||
_errorMessage =
|
||||
"Erreur lors de la récupération des données utilisateur.";
|
||||
@ -90,6 +93,7 @@ class _LoginPageState extends State<LoginPage> {
|
||||
}
|
||||
|
||||
void _togglePasswordVisibility() {
|
||||
if (!mounted) return;
|
||||
setState(() {
|
||||
_obscurePassword = !_obscurePassword;
|
||||
});
|
||||
|
Reference in New Issue
Block a user